Add 75/7 and 10/8
1st number: 10 5/7, 2nd number: 1 2/8
75/7 + 10/8 is 335/28.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 7 and 8 is 56
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 56 - For the 1st fraction, since 7 × 8 = 56,
75/7 = 75 × 8/7 × 8 = 600/56 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 7 = 56,
10/8 = 10 × 7/8 × 7 = 70/56 - Add the two like fractions:
600/56 + 70/56 = 600 + 70/56 = 670/56 - 670/56 simplified gives 335/28
- So, 75/7 + 10/8 = 335/28
